Scope and content
Item is the piano part of a first edition publication of Mozart's Piano Concerto No. 23. The piano part includes cues for the orchestral instruments.

Signatures note
The part includes annotations in pencil, possibly by Clara Schumann. The front cover bears the names of Clara Schumann and Theodor Avé-Lallemant, dated January 25, 1861.
